What Is Enamel Pin. An enamel pin is a metal pin with some kind of decorative enamel on it. Hard enamel pins are flat and smooth, and soft enamel pins have raised metal edges. What exactly are enamel pins? A lapel pin, also known as an enamel pin, [1] [2] is a small pin worn on clothing, often on the lapel of a jacket, attached to a bag, or displayed on a piece of fabric.
